Output 80dc4f7c0d96c6dd38efbdc663448cd3e787913b5cc0c51db8033c96298a9a06:1

value
23328780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1281f37b97eca94be73c7526e8a089da39310134 OP_EQUAL
address
33NsmA6uGrhaNo6S4UPd1ZP9SjjsXk6FLy
transaction
80dc4f7c0d96c6dd38efbdc663448cd3e787913b5cc0c51db8033c96298a9a06
spent
true